M

I recently purchased chassis from Direct Chassis a...

I recently purchased chassis from Direct Chassis and I am extremely satisfied with their products. The quality is top-notch and the prices are competitive. The customer service team was very helpful throughout the purchasing process. I highly recommend Direct Chassis for all your chassis needs. They are reliable and deliver on their promises.

Comments:

No comments